BEFORE WE ARRIVE

Protect your property in Glenferness while help is on the way

If water is spreading in Glenferness, move valuables away from wet areas and close the nearest isolation valve or main stopcock when it is safe to do so. Avoid harsh chemicals, forced plunging on overflowing toilets, or opening electrical panels near water. Tell us immediately if sewage, ceiling leaks, or electrical risk is involved so we can prioritise your call.

Active pipe leakClose the nearest isolation valve or main stopcock if it is safe and accessible. Move valuables away from the wet area.Get practical help ›
Blocked drainStop using connected sinks, toilets or appliances. Do not keep flushing when water is rising or backing up.Get practical help ›
Geyser leakSwitch off the geyser electrical supply at the distribution board and close the cold-water feed where safely possible.Get practical help ›
Low water pressureCheck whether neighbours are affected and whether every fixture or only one outlet has reduced flow.Get practical help ›

PRACTICAL DECISION SUPPORT

Temporary control vs permanent repair in Glenferness

Many Glenferness customers ask whether a quick fix is enough. We explain when shut-off and containment are appropriate short-term steps, and when pipe condition, recurring symptoms, or access mean a proper repair is the trustworthy long-term choice.

A repair can make senseA repair is usually reasonable when the failed part is accessible, the surrounding material is sound and testing indicates that the problem is isolated rather than recurring.
?
Replacement may offer better valueReplacement deserves consideration when components are badly corroded, repeatedly failing, difficult to access or likely to cause another damaging interruption soon after repair.
Further testing may be necessaryWhere the symptom does not reveal the source, controlled isolation, pressure checks or drainage testing can prevent unnecessary opening work and replacement of serviceable parts.

How can I tell whether a plumbing fault can safely wait?

Treat it as urgent when delay risks water damage, contamination, electrical contact, or loss of toilets or hot water. Isolate water if safe and keep people clear.

What should I do before the plumber arrives?

Move valuables from wet areas, keep people away from contaminated water, and close the local stopcock if you can reach it safely. Do not open electrics or pressurised fittings.
